Description de l’éditeur

State Enterprise (1971) examines nationalized industries and their political control. It looks at their objectives, and the guidance given to the politicians tasked with running these industries, as well as the qualifications needed, and the performance demanded of them. Many of the contributions to the debate about government–board relations in the nationalized industries were made by economists, but the author concludes, through a thorough analysis of the attempt to apply new methods of economic decision-making, that the results of this debate have not done much to settle the basic problems of running nationalized industries.
